Brief Summary
Polestar Automotive UK PLC’s Q1 2025 revenue of $711.3 million surpassed expectations, although it reported a significant EPS loss of -$8.4621 per share.
Impact of The News
The financial briefing for Polestar Automotive UK PLC shows a mixed performance with a revenue of $711.3 million, which exceeded market expectations set at $677 million. Despite this revenue outperformance, the company reported a substantial loss, with an EPS of -$8.4621, indicating financial distress Zhitong.
